## 3.2.0 — Changed defaults

The Moonpull tide-table widget no longer fetches station data over plain HTTP; TLS is now mandatory and the downgrade fallback was removed. Cache TTL for tide predictions dropped from 24h to 6h. Anonymous query logging is off by default. Embeds from unlisted origins are rejected. Security reviewers should confirm deployments match the new baseline. The shipped defaults for the widget service are listed below.

config for bagep-kageg:
ULADOR_LOG_LEVEL=warn
ULADOR_METRICS_HOST=metrics.ulador.tolvaqcorp.corp
ULADOR_POOL_SIZE=32

Leadership Review Briefing — FY Headcount

Heads of department: next year's plan holds total headcount flat at Corvane Analytics. Engineering gains six roles, offset by attrition-led reductions in field ops. No backfills in admin until Q2. Contractor spend capped at this year's level. Submit revised org charts before the Ellsworth offsite; exceptions need CFO sign-off. Rationale for the engineering tilt, tied to our product direction, appears in the confidential note below.

management briefing: Project Ulavan slips by two quarters because of the staffing delay.

## Service Accounts — StormFan Alert Fan-Out

The fan-out worker authenticates to the internal dispatch tier using the svc-stormfan account. Rotate quarterly; scopes are limited to publish-only on alert topics. If deliveries stall during your shift, verify the worker is using the current credential, reproduced below for reference.

API key for kaweg-hahif: kto4_rAjZ

## WebSocket Compression Notes (Brightgate Relay)

Enabling permessage-deflate on the relay cut bandwidth roughly 40% for chat payloads, but CPU on the edge nodes rose measurably and per-connection memory grew due to sliding-window buffers. We chose a small window and no context takeover to cap memory at the cost of ratio. Please verify the tradeoff holds under the load test before approving. The active settings are as follows:

service settings:
PRAIX_LOG_LEVEL=error
PRAIX_METRICS_HOST=metrics.praix.qorvelcorp.corp
PRAIX_POOL_SIZE=16